Output 6a6066ea4961eff8ed4cdc106b63ba548b456aaaccacf6d2299d72f873075f54:10

value
8328965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4869b6ce5102d1886efacc473cd41fc789686574 OP_EQUAL
address
38HuDVtqH2AxUkAZcFXxrJL6ZSw34pGjb3
transaction
6a6066ea4961eff8ed4cdc106b63ba548b456aaaccacf6d2299d72f873075f54
spent
true